Program Overview
The Graduate Innovation Program (GIP) is designed to support university students and faculty in transforming ideas, research, and final year projects into commercially viable and scalable ventures
The program provides participants with comprehensive support, including expert business coaching, business development assistance, and funding opportunities, to enable successful commercialization and market entry. The program is a bridge between academia and market-ready solutions.
